Python Academy
前往频道在 Telegram
Python Academy — один канал вместо тысячи учебников Чат канала: @python_academy_chat Сотрудничество: @zubar89 Канал включён в перечень РКН: https://rkn.link/TVu
显示更多📈 Telegram 频道 Python Academy 的分析概览
频道 Python Academy (@python_academy) 俄语 语言赛道中的 是活跃参与者。目前社区聚集了 44 499 名订阅者,在 技术与应用 类别中位列第 3 048,并在 俄罗斯 地区排名第 14 340 位。
📊 受众指标与增长动态
自 невідомо 创建以来,项目保持高速增长,吸引了 44 499 名订阅者。
根据 11 六月, 2026 的最新数据,频道保持稳定运转。过去 30 天订阅人数变化为 -109,过去 24 小时变化为 -5,整体触达仍然可观。
- 认证状态: 未认证
- 互动率 (ER): 平均受众互动率为 5.58%。内容发布后 24 小时内通常能获得 2.69% 的反应,占订阅者总量。
- 帖子覆盖: 每篇帖子平均可获得 2 482 次浏览,首日通常累积 1 197 次浏览。
- 互动与反馈: 受众积极参与,单帖平均反应数为 4。
- 主题关注点: 内容集中在 строка, модуль, документация, taskiq, yaml 等核心主题上。
📝 描述与内容策略
作者将该频道定位为表达主观观点的平台:
“Python Academy — один канал вместо тысячи учебников
Чат канала: @python_academy_chat
Сотрудничество: @zubar89
Канал включён в перечень РКН: https://rkn.link/TVu”
凭借高频更新(最新数据采集于 12 六月, 2026),频道始终保持新鲜度与高覆盖。分析显示受众积极互动,使其成为 技术与应用 类别中的关键影响点。
44 499
订阅者
-524 小时
-417 天
-10930 天
帖子存档
44 494
Пакеты
Пакет — это, грубо говоря, папка с Python модулями. Помимо разделения проекта по частям, пакеты нужны для создания пространства имен, чтобы работать с модулями через точку, как в примере на картинке.
При импорте
from package import * будут подключены либо все модули и объекты модуля __init__.py, либо то, что находится в переменной __all__ в том же модуле __init__.py.
Еще примечателен файл __init__.py, который раньше был обязателен для создания пакетов. Но с версии Python 3.3 его необходимость пропала. Однако его функциональность на этом не заканчиваются.
#модули #пакеты44 494
Какую профессию выбрать, чтобы она приносила и удовольствие и высокий доход? А если я гуманитарий? А мне не поздно менять профессию?
Бесплатный профориентационный проект «IT-рентген» от SkillFactory развеет все сомнения и покажет, какая профессия вам подходит с учетом ваших интересов, знаний и опыта. На пути к новой профессии предстоит сделать 4 простых, но важных шага. Готовы?
Начните с прохождения теста, который определит что вам ближе: программирование, Data Science, аналитика данных, дизайн, менеджмент или маркетинг.
А дальше ваш путь пройдет через практикум, прямые эфиры, консультации — и приведет вас к новой профессии! Вы познакомитесь с представителями индустрии, узнаете их истории и рекомендации, и получите ответы на все вопросы.
📌Пройти тест "Какой путь в IT - ваш" - https://clc.to/cMGcvA
44 494
Создаем словарь из набора ключей
Для создания словаря из известного набора ключей и одинаковых значений часто используют генераторы словарей (dict comprehensions).
Однако класс
dict имеет удобный метод fromkeys, который был создан специально для таких случаев.
#словари #fromkeys44 494
По данным исследований ВШЭ, 60% людей в России занимаются нелюбимым делом. Ты всё ещё среди них?
Попробуй дизайн — в этой сфере всегда найдутся креативные задачи, а ключевыми навыками можно овладеть всего за 3 месяца. Спрос на дизайнеров в нашей стране вырос на 78% за 2021 год, специалисты получают от 80k, а верхней планки вообще нет.
Запишись на новый поток мощного курса «Профессия веб-дизайнер» от Тинькофф и Qmarketing Academy. За 3 месяца ты:
— Прокачаешь базу: основы композиции, цвета и типографики.
— Научишься создавать интерфейсы в Figma, статичные баннеры в Adobe Photoshop, лендинги в Tilda и Readymag, анимации в After Effects.
— Соберешь конкурентное портфолио во время курса на реальных заказах от топовых компаний: Перекресток, QIWI, Кухня на районе.
Тебя ждет насыщенная программа без «воды»: 31 час теории, 75 часов практики, живые сессии «вопрос-ответ» с экспертами, карьерная консультация и доступ к чату с вакансиями «для своих».
Оставляй заявку по ссылке, пока действует лучшая цена!
44 494
Ключевое слово nonlocal
Похожее по функционалу на global, ключевое слово
nonlocal позволяет обращаться к переменным из нелокальной области видимости.
Поведение nonlocal заключается в том, что интерпретатор ищет переменную в ближайшей области видимости.
Основное различие с global в том, что с помощью nonlocal нельзя получить переменные из глобальной области видимости.
#переменные #nonlocal44 494
Книги по Python 🐍 - канал, где вы можете бесплатно КАЧАТЬ книги по Python в два клика.
- качай книги
- читай
- становись программистом.
- зарабатывай 100-400 тысяч рублей.
Все книги 2015-2020 годов. Много русскоязычных.
Подписывайтесь: @pythonbookarchive
44 494
Ключевое слово global
Изначально мы не можем изменять значение переменной в другой области видимости, но мы можем это сделать, переопределив область видимости на глобальную, с помощью ключевого слова
global.
Мы даже можем определить новую глобальную переменную внутри функции, но не нужно этим злоупотреблять, т.к. это будет засорять глобальную область и приводить к нежелательным ошибкам
#переменные #global44 494
Комфорт и анонимность - слагаемые успеха Telegram-обменника Зеленая Свеча
Сохрани в избранное, что бы не потерять! 🤑
♻️Моментальный обмен Криптовалюты на Qiwi, Сбербанк, Яндекс.Деньги, Webmoney и наличные;
(они даже выдают кеш в любой точке России)
👀 Не требуется верификации;
🔁 Популярные направления;
🤑 Всегда есть ВСЁ в наличии.
Сайт: https://green-obmenka.ru/
44 494
Нижнее подчеркивание
В Python имя переменной может состоять из одного подчеркивания. Хотя такое имя не достаточно описательно и не должно использоваться, есть по крайней мере три случая, когда
_ имеет общепринятый смысл.
Первое, _ используется, когда вам нужно придумать имена для значений, которые вам не нужны — например, в циклах for.
Второе, интерактивный режим использует _ для хранения результата последнего выполненного выражения.
Третье, документация модуля gettext рекомендует псевдоним _() для функции gettext(), чтобы минимизировать загромождение вашего кода.
#тонкости44 494
Хэширование
Для создания хэш-значений в python существует удобный модуль
hashlib, реализующий общий интерфейс для ряда популярных хэш функций и также может использовать функции доступные в системе, предоставляемые с установленным OpenSSL.
Использование очень простое, в модуле существует ряд конструкторов, соответствующих названиям хэш-функций. В конструктор мы можем передать байт-строку, хэш которой мы хотим получить, на выходе мы получим объект хэша. Объект хэша мы можем обновить методом update, сконкатенировав тем самым строки, а также можем можем вывести полученное значение с помощью методов digest и hexdigest. Первый возвращает байт-строку, второй - в шестнадцатеричном формате.
#hash #hashlib44 494
Улучшайте чужие бизнесы и получайте высокую зарплату
А что, если вам скажут, что вы можете получить крутую специальность в области бизнес-аналитики меньше чем за год? И, как следствие, начать зарабатывать сотни тысяч рублей в месяц и гордиться собой?
Но давайте по порядку: кто такой Business Analyst? Это человек, который помогает компаниям правильно использовать финансы, находить слабые места и оптимизировать все бизнес-процессы. То есть зарабатывать еще больше денег, поэтому и зарплаты таким людям платят довольно щедрые.
Курс онлайн-университета SF Education — хороший способ освоить эту востребованную профессию. За 11 месяцев вы научитесь анализировать финансовые и продуктовые метрики, изучите четыре языка программирования и овладеете методиками эффективного планирования, внедрения и управления изменениями. Преподаватели — эксперты из реального сектора с международными сертификатами, тратят 50% на теорию, остальное — практика. А личный куратор поможет пройти первый этап отбора в компанию «Большой четверки» — KPMG.
SF Education также добавило в курс изучение бизнес-английского, чтобы сделать вас еще более ценным сотрудником. Кстати, у них есть и другие программы для роста, например, «Excel Academy», «Личные финансы», «Data Science Academy».
Так что переходите по ссылке и изучайте программу!
А по промокоду PYTHON до 3 сентября - 20% скидка на подбор курса
44 494
Корутины
Некой противоположностью генераторов являются корутины. Для примера напишем функцию, которая будет в бесконечном цикле подставлять значение и выводить строку.
Обратите внимание на то, как было использовано ключевое слово
yield. При таком написании создаётся не генератор, а корутина, что позволяет не просто генерировать значения, но и принимать их.
Функция работает так: при отправке значения через метод send локальная переменная name принимает его, а далее значение подставляется в строку и выводится на экран.
#генераторы #корутины44 494
Почему Python — отличный выбор для входа в IT
Смотрите сами: максимально простой, понятный и удобный для старта в программировании язык. Изучив который, вы сможете решать задачи в разных областях: от разработки мобильных приложений до компьютерного зрения.
Согласно исследованию GitHub, в 2021 году Python занял 2 место в рейтинге языков программирования. А на HeadHunter открыто более 2000 вакансий, что говорит о популярности не только у разработчиков, но и среди работодателей.
И освоить эту профессию, даже если вы всегда считали себя гуманитарием, можно в SkillFactory. Курсы на 80% состоит из практики в разных форматах, что позволяет найти работу еще во время обучения. Координаторы и менторы будут сопровождать вас на протяжении всего обучения. А в конце обучения вас ждет стажировка в одной из компаний-партнеров, которая пополнит ваше резюме реальным опытом работы!
📌Оставь заявку на бесплатную карьерную консультацию — https://clc.to/6_DZTw
44 494
Генераторы
Функции-генераторы выглядят как и обычные, но вместо
return содержат выражения с ключевым словом yield для последовательного генерирования значений.
Вызов подобной функции вернёт не значение, а объект генератора. Далее из этого объекта можно получать значения, например, с помощью функции next или циклом for.
Если генератору больше нечего возвращать, то будет вызвано исключение StopIteration. В целом, генератор — это особый, более изящный случай итератора.
#генераторы44 494
Новое поколение ноутбуков на базе AMD Ryzen™ 4000-й серии - мощный инструмент для решения широкого спектра программных задач!
⚡️Удвоенная энергоэффективность мобильных процессоров - до 12 часов непрерывной автономной работы без подзарядки;
⚡️До 8 ядер с поддержкой многопоточности - для минимального времени загрузок, оперативного анализа и моментальных запусков проектов и ресурсоёмких приложений;
⚡️Инновационная видеокарта Radeon - для работы сразу на нескольких мониторах с разрешением 4К и в формате Full-HD и с максимальными настройками графики!
44 494
Определение литеральных типов
Когда нам может понадобится определить из полученной строки литеральный тип (строки, числа, списки, кортежи, словари, логические значения и None), мы можем воспользоваться функцией
literal_eval() из модуля ast.
Данная функция поможет безопасно определить литеральный тип, а в случае если был передан не литерал, то выбросит исключение. Это можно использовать для оценки выражений из внешних источников при парсинге файлов, либо пользовательского ввода.
#ast #literal_eval44 494
3 трюка с itertools
Начнем с функции
combinations: она позволяет составлять комбинации элементов из итерируемых объектов без повторений. Первый аргумент это сам объект, а второй — длина комбинации.
Для того, чтобы составить комбинацию с повторениями, используют функцию combinations_with_replacement. Делает она абсолютно все то же самое что и предыдущая, с одним исключением – теперь в комбинации могут быть повторы.
Ну и в заключение, рассмотрим функцию compress, применяющую "маску" из второго аргумента функции к первому. То есть, если в маске на этом месте стоит единица, то в исходном массиве элемент остается нетронутым, и наоборот.
#itertools44 494
Как стать сотрудником Google или продать свой стартап за миллионы долларов
Для этого вам нужно пройти курс-интенсив по прототипированию от лучших специалистов по AI. К концу курса вы создадите свой проект, соберете в него живых пользователей и привлечете инвестиции.
Почему ещё стоит записаться именно на этот курс:
1. Ощутимый результат. Это не какие-то сертификаты, а полноценный проект, который вы создадите: от профессиональной технической и инвестиционной оценки идеи до реализации в виде продукта с живыми пользователями.
2. Мощные преподаватели. Это просто команда мечты: Юрий Мельничек — AI-инвестор, основатель AIMATTER (был куплен Google в 2017 году), Алёна Трескова — старший аналитик в Ozon, Айра Монгуш — основательница Mathshub, Роман Григоров — разработчик с 20-летним опытом в Parallels.
3. Скорость. Чтобы достичь таких результатов не нужны годы практики и обучения в вузе. На всё у нас уйдёт 56 часов теории и 40 часов практики. Почему так мало? Потому что в курсе нет воды и устаревших знаний, всё сделано так, чтобы вы могли использовать полученные навыки в реальных проектах.
Оставьте заявку сейчас: осталось всего 5 мест, а старт уже 27 августа. Чтобы зарегистрироваться на курс — нажмите на эту ссылку
44 494
Сохранение документации функции при декорировании
У декораторов существует ряд проблем, одна из которых заключается в том, что, после оборачивания функции в декоратор, на выходе мы не можем получить информацию атрибутов
__name__ и __doc__, нужные для документации функции.
Вместо значений данных атрибутов исходной функции мы будем получать значения функции обертки.
Для решения этой проблемы можно воспользоваться декоратором functools.wraps, применяя его к обертке нашего декоратора. В результате имя и сигнатура функции, передаваемой в декоратор, будут копироваться в обертку.
#декораторы #wraps44 494
Супер предложение для начинающих питонистов - успей поучаствовать в кодинг марафоне из 10 задач.
Всем участникам - ревью кода.
Как это работает:
- вы решаете задачи на питоне
- присылаете нам
- мы ревьювим ваш код и говорим что хорошо, а что нет
Вы решаете задачки, кто решает больше других - выигрывает от 1000 до 3000 рублей.
Одни плюсы. Марафон уже кончается - успейте поучаствовать и проверить качество вашего кодярника.
Правила конкурса у нас в канале PythonBoost.
现已上线!2025 年 Telegram 研究 — 年度关键洞察 
